In 'Robert Burns' by John Campbell Shairp, readers are taken on a comprehensive journey through the life and works of the famous Scottish poet. Shairp's scholarly analysis of Burns' poetry provides valuable insights into the literary style of the time and the socio-political context in which Burns wrote. The book delves into the themes of love, nature, and patriotism that are prevalent in Burns' writings, offering a deep understanding of the poet's emotional and intellectual significance. Shairp's detailed examinations of Burns' most famous works, such as 'Auld Lang Syne' and 'To a Mouse,' showcase the poet's enduring influence on Scottish literature. Shairp's writing is engaging and accessible, making this book a must-read for both scholars and poetry enthusiasts alike. John Campbell Shairp, a renowned Scottish scholar and writer, brings his expertise in literature and history to 'Robert Burns.' His deep admiration for Burns' poetry is evident throughout the book, as he skillfully unpacks the complexities of the poet's life and works. Shairp's passion for Scottish culture and history shines through in his meticulous research and thoughtful analysis of Burns' legacy.
